How to Bill for HCPCS Code C1832

## Definition

The Healthcare Common Procedure Coding System code C1832 pertains to “Magnetic resonance (MR) guided focused ultrasound (MRgFUS) ablation device for intracranial lesions.” It is categorized under the HCPCS level II codes, which are primarily used for medical devices, equipment, and supplies that are not covered under Current Procedural Terminology (CPT) codes. Specifically, C1832 refers to a device utilized in the non-invasive treatment of brain conditions, leveraging magnetic resonance imaging guidance for precise delivery of ultrasound waves to targeted intracranial areas.

This code is often associated with procedures intended to treat conditions such as essential tremor, Parkinson’s disease, or other neurological disorders characterized by abnormal brain activity or tissue lesions. The use of the device aids physicians in delivering highly focused ultrasound waves, resulting in the destruction of the targeted tissue without affecting surrounding healthy tissue. The inclusion of this code in claims submissions signifies both the utilization of this specific device and the highly advanced nature of the procedure involved.

## Clinical Context

Use of the MR-guided focused ultrasound (MRgFUS) ablation device, as encapsulated by HCPCS code C1832, is typically indicated in cases where minimally invasive intervention for intracranial conditions is preferable to open surgery. Many patients with conditions such as essential tremor or other movement disorders are treated using this technology when pharmacological treatment options are inadequate or contraindicated. Neurosurgeons and other specialists favor MRgFUS over traditional surgical techniques due to its precision and diminished risk of complications.

The MRgFUS device plays a pivotal role in the broader context of stereotactic neurosurgery, which involves 3D imaging to direct therapeutic interventions with high accuracy. Its most common use to date has been in interventions targeting the thalamus, specifically in patients suffering from tremor-related diseases that are refractory to medication. The device allows for real-time imaging and continuous monitoring, ensuring that only the abnormal tissue is ablated.

## Documentation Requirements

Clinical documentation supporting the use of C1832 must demonstrate thorough justification for the procedure. Medical records should include a comprehensive neurological assessment and evidence that non-invasive or less complex treatments were attempted but deemed insufficient. Documentation should also reflect detailed imaging studies, including the necessity for magnetic resonance guidance during the procedure.

In addition to pre-procedural documentation, physicians must provide a detailed operative note that outlines the use of the MRgFUS device, including the exact location and extent of the ablations performed. Post-operative records should include patient outcomes, any complications, and additional tracking or follow-up as applicable. The justification for the choice of this advanced technology over other traditional methods must also be clearly indicated, as payers often require proof that the use of such a specialized device was clinically warranted.

## Common Denial Reasons

One of the most frequent denial reasons associated with the submission of claims for C1832 is insufficient documentation. Payers may reject or query claims if the medical necessity for the MRgFUS device is indecisive or poorly substantiated. Denials can also stem from not providing evidence that less costly or non-invasive alternatives were either ineffective or medically inappropriate for the patient.

Another common reason for denial is improper use of modifiers. Incorrect or missing modifiers such as -LT or -RT could lead to claim rejections or underpayment. Furthermore, it is not uncommon for prior authorization denials to result when insurers do not recognize C1832 as a justified intervention for the indicated condition. Prior authorization is increasingly mandated by payers for the approval of advanced or emerging technologies.
